This restaurant has a laid-back, casual vibe to it. But there is nothing casual about the cuisine, both in terms of its thoughtfulness and preparation. On that score the food is as high end as you can get. Dining solo did not give me the chance to range very far across the many smaller plates available but I saw enough good stuff on neighboring tables and had enough outstanding food on my own table to sense the restaurant's depth. A simple hummus dish was remarkable for a presentation that included a ring of hummus, a portion of tahini with fresh parsley, a pile of chickpeas, and a drizzle of olive oil which when mixed together and eaten with the soft, piping hot pita bread was outstanding. I ordered the Moroccan brick chicken--an airline chicken breast--and it was transportingly good. The chicken was moist and tender as butter with deep flavor and a nicely browned skin and even the small arugula salad served on the side was amazing with radish and onion and a simple mustard vinaigrette giving the whole plate perfect balance. All the flavors balanced out, including even the dessert of Turkish coffee chocolate mousse: a case study in balanced flavor as the unctuous and perfect mousse was given a crunchy element with cocoa nibs and then a contrasting sour element with a wonderful passion fruit sauce swirled onto the plate. This is high order cookery. Highly recommended!

While the food was delicious, the portions are extremely small and the prices are quite high. If you're ready to spend at least $50 per person for dinner (which I'm not), go for it. I was not impressed with $23 for a tiny lamb kebab and a half cup of salad, and $18 for two tiny grilled octopus tentacles. Again, it was delicious, wonderfully spiced, and perfectly cooked with interesting flavors, but this isn't a place to go if you're hungry.
